Level Four Advisory Services LLC Purchases 142 Shares of Iron Mountain Incorporated (NYSE:IRM)

Level Four Advisory Services LLC boosted its holdings in shares of Iron Mountain Incorporated (NYSE:IRMFree Report) by 1.4% in the 4th qu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the SEC. The firm owned 10,339 shares of the financial services provider’s stock after buying an additional 142 shares during the period. Level Four Advisory Services LLC’s holdings in Iron Mountain were worth $1,087,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Iron Mountain Price Performance

Shares of Iron Mountain stock opened at $85.07 on Friday. The stock has a market capitalization of $24.99 billion, a P/E ratio of 139.46,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 5.15 and a beta of 1.04. Iron Mountain Incorporated has a one year low of $73.53 and a one year high of $130.24. The business’s 50 day simple moving average is $94.97 and its two-hundred day simple moving average is $108.35.

Iron Mountain (NYSE:IRMG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, February 13th. The financial services provider reported $0.50 earnings per share for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$1.20 by ($0.70). The firm had revenue of $1.58 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$1.60 billion. Iron Mountain had a net margin of 2.95% and a negative return on equity of 401.83%. During the same period in the previous year, the company earned $0.52 EPS. Sell-side analysts expect that Iron Mountain Incorporated will post 4.54 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Iron Mountain Increases Dividend

The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, April 4th. Shareholders of record on Monday, March 17th will be given a dividend of $0.785 per share. This is a positive change from Iron Mountain’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.72.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Monday, March 17th. This represents a $3.14 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 3.69%. Iron Mountain’s dividend payout ratio is presently 514.75%.

Iron Mountain Company Profile

(Free Report)

Iron Mountain Incorporated (NYSE: IRM) is a global leader in information management services. Founded in 1951 and trusted by more than 240,000 customers worldwide, Iron Mountain serves to protect and elevate the power of our customers’ work. Through a range of offerings including digital transformation, data centers, secure records storage, information management, asset lifecycle management, secure destruction and art storage and logistics, Iron Mountain helps businesses bring light to their dark data, enabling customers to unlock value and intelligence from their stored digital and physical assets at speed and with security, while helping them meet their environmental goals.
